Randle Receives Support from Around the NBA

After suffering a fractured tibia in Tuesday’s season opener, Julius Randle is expected to miss the rest of the 2014-15 season. Following Randle’s injury, support flowed in from all across the NBA for the Lakers rookie.

Fellow Lakers

Randle’s Laker teammates reached out to the 19-year-old in postgame interviews and through social media.

Kobe Bryant

“Even for myself, being a veteran, dealing with something like this is tough. Him being a 19-year-old kid, it’s tough. But that’s what we’re here for. We’re here to pick him up and help him through it and take it day-by-day.”

”I think what this franchise has always been good about doing is surrounding the young players with players who have come before. And he has a great cast surrounding him: myself and James Worthy, A.C. Green, Magic (Johnson). We’re all there, so we’ll help him through this, and he’ll come back a better basketball player.”

Jeremy Lin

“Just keep your head up, man. It comes and goes, and you can never really take things for granted. And I’ve been through a lot of ups and downs in my career. Just try to stay positive and know when (you) get healthy, (you’ll) be able to go out and do (your) thing again.

Carlos Boozer

“It was tough, man, but you saw our camaraderie. We all went over there, tried to help him out, give him support.”

Byron Scott

“It’s hard. When you have a young guy like that go down, you’re already thin with the injuries that we have, so it makes it that much harder. But I think the last three or four minutes (of the game) obviously we weren’t thinking a whole lot about basketball. We were really thinking about Julius and just hoping he was OK.”
